Output 3cc81c060c5bed336397818502475abef9b2b0abfdec7c75819aafc2136185ae:0

value
22682
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d412edbd7ec04cc4908a1118b7e290c60a5a8e1a31d9db646c8999f359483d7d
address
bc1p6sfwm0t7cpxvfyy2zyvt0c5scc994rs6x8vakerv3xvlxk2g847st7q3l4
transaction
3cc81c060c5bed336397818502475abef9b2b0abfdec7c75819aafc2136185ae
spent
true